Scientists have made a petition to the countries participating in the upcoming conference on climate change in Glasgow, according to news.ru.
According to them, the Earth is facing a catastrophe worse than the COVID-19 epidemic. We are talking about the rise in temperature on the planet. According to experts, the consequences will be much worse than with a pandemic that has now swept the whole world. Scientists believe that air pollution from burning fossil fuels causes more than seven million premature deaths every year. As follows from the petition, only in 2021 in China, Pakistan, India, Vietnam, as well as Germany, Canada and Belgium, there were such major cataclysms that they caused harm to the population.
It is expected that due to poor quality food, water and air, there will be an increase in the incidence of diseases on the planet. According to the forecast, the temperature on the Earth in the current century will rise by 2.7-3.1 degrees Celsius at a rate of 1.5 degrees. According to scientists, financing the development of clean energy, as well as reducing greenhouse gas emissions, and measures to improve the health of the world's inhabitants will help to avoid a climate catastrophe.
